Works under the direction of the Police Finance Manager in assuming a strategic role in the overall financial management of the division. Assists in providing timely and accurate analysis of budgets, financial trends, and forecasts for a $300 million budget. Manages the day-to-day financial operations of the division by implementing, supervising and monitoring all financial-related activities for accounting, finance, forecasting, strategic planning, job costing, legal, property management, deal analysis and negotiations. Recommends ways to strategically enhance financial performance and business opportunities for the division. Ensures that effective internal controls are in place and that the department is compliant with General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) – and applicable federal, state and local regulatory laws and rules for financial and tax reporting. Provides information or clarifies policies and procedures for division management staff as requested. Develops, implements, and maintains a comprehensive job cost system and budget process. Supervises all aspects of the Finance & Accounting functions of the division. Evaluates and advises on the impact of long-range planning, introduction of new programs/strategies and regulatory actions. Establishes and maintains strong relationships with the command staff. Provides executive management with recommendations on the financial implications of business and police activities. Partners effectively with the City Finance Division and other Finance/Budget personnel.
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Finance, Accounting, or a related field and at least eight (8) years in progressively responsible financial leadership roles with working knowledge of accounting, forecasting, budget preparation, and personnel/payroll operating procedures with six (6) of the eight (8) years of management-level experience in directing financial activities; or any combination of experience or training which enables one to perform the essential job functions
